Default Setting Change when AirPrice Includes Fare Basis Code. |
1G |
The rules validation default setting is being changed when an AirPrice request including a fare basis code is sent. By validating the rules of the fare when a fare basis code is included in the AirPrice request, users can expect the fare in the AirPrice response to be applicable to the input criteria. This will be enabled after August 21, 2025. For example, when sending an AirPrice request that includes a FareBasis code but no FareRuleValidation indicator is included, the system defaults to validating the rules of the fare and fails with NO VALID FARE FOR INPUT CRITERIA, because, for example, the fare is not valid for the flight, date or booking code in the request. See DA-1081 for further information. |
Air Pricing | No |
Air.xsd AirPriceReq/FareRuleValidation="true" or "false" |
Support quantity for C type bags sold by weight. |
1G |
This enhancement provides the ability to book multiple quantities of extra bags when they can be sold by weight. In AirMerchandisingFulfillment, when booking C type extra bags that are sold by weight, if the quantity field is set to more than 1, then Universal API calculates the total weight amount and adds the SSR according to the total weight entered based on the carrier filing.
|
No |
Air.xsd AirCreateReservationRsp/UniversalRecord/AirReservation/OptionalServices/OptionalService @SSRFreeText |
